Identifying Wasp Nests
To determine wasp nests, thoroughly observe your surroundings and seek unique physical features that suggest their presence. One vital indication is the existence of wasps flying in and out of a specific area. Take note of areas such as eaves, rooflines, and tree branches, where wasps typically construct their nests.

Safe and Effective Wasp Nest Removal
When managing the presence of a wasp nest, it is necessary to recognize exactly how to securely and properly remove it. Right here are some professional methods to help you with risk-free wasp nest removal:
- ** Protective Apparel **: Always use safety clothes, such as long sleeves, trousers, handwear covers, and a beekeeping veil, to protect yourself from possible stings.
- ** Evening Elimination **: Wasps are much less energetic in the evening, so it's ideal to get rid of the nest after sundown when they're much less most likely to be aggressive.
- ** Using Pesticide **: Apply a pesticide specifically developed for wasp nest removal. Splash it straight onto the nest, covering the whole surface.
Preventing Wasp Nests in the Future
To stop future wasp nests, take positive measures to eliminate attractants around your building. Beginning by sealing any fractures or openings in your walls, windows, and doors to stop wasps from getting in and developing nests.
Keep your garbage cans firmly sealed and frequently throw away food waste to avoid drawing in wasps. Furthermore, remove any type of potential nesting sites by frequently checking and maintaining your property. Cut tree branches, bushes, and shrubs that may give a suitable spot for wasps to build their nests.
Stay clear of leaving standing water or uncovered food and drinks outside, as this can likewise bring in wasps. By taking these aggressive steps, you can significantly lower the possibility of future wasp nests and enjoy a wasp-free setting.
